In the
Senior Soccer Finals held at
Veterans Field on Thursday the St.
Christopher Cyclones took top
honours in both Girls and Boys
Division in the LSSAA finals.

This was
the fourth year that Northern and
St. Christopher met in the LSSAA
Girls finals and the first time in
the 4 years that St. Christopher
took the title.
In the
girls semi finals the #3 seed St.
Christopher defeated #2 seeded LCCVI
Lancers to earn a spot in the final
round.
After regulation time both sides
were even 1 - 1. Jenn Spinozzi
scored the St. Christopher goal and
Nikki Arthur scored for Northern.
After regulation time the game went
into overtime where a winner wasn't
decided and sent the game into a
shoot out. In an exciting
shoot out the score was tied 3 - 2
after 5 shooters. It went down to
the 8th shooter where Northern came
up empty and Taylor Chrapko found
the opening to give the St.
Christopher Cyclones the win for the
first time in 4 years.
Outstanding goaltending from both
sides with Alysha Puglsey in net for
Northern and Jenn Rogers taking the
win for St. Christopher.
The Cyclones are coached by Frank
Brennan and Daniela Azzolina and
after the game Coach Brennan who was
extremely happy with the outcome
said, "this was the most intense
game we have played all year, we
were a little short handed but the
girls played hard whistle to
whistle. Northern is a hard
team to beat and I'm proud of our
girls accomplishments".
Both
teams now move on and will play for
the SWOSSA title in the AA and AAA
divisions. The semi finals for
the girls will be played in Sarnia
with Date/time/location to be
announced.
